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

lezão

Autenticação de usuario

Recommended Posts

Ola boa noite galera!

 

Estou desde das 17:30 procurando modelo de um ...

Alguém de vc6 tem algum modelo ou alguma ideia de como fazer isso, ja estou quase loco....

Compartilhar este post


Link para o post
Compartilhar em outros sites

Estou usando assim

 

<%

   if not session("status") = "ok" then
   	  'Redirecionamos para a Página de Login e informamos o erro	
      response.redirect("login.asp?erro=negado") 
      'Lembrando que o response.redirect deve ser usado antes 
	  'de qualquer saída HTML.
   else
      <%@LANGUAGE="VBSCRIPT" CODEPAGE="1252"%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
</head>

<body>

Olá <% = session("nome")%> boa noite!
</body>
</html>
   end if
   
%>

Estou certo

Compartilhar este post


Link para o post
Compartilhar em outros sites

Como assim ?

 

eu coloquei Olá <% = session("nome")%> boa noite!

 

Só q envéz de aparecer o nome do usuario aparece a palavra OK ...

pq esta assim aonde eu estou errando?

Compartilhar este post


Link para o post
Compartilhar em outros sites

eu coloquei Olá <% = session("nome")%> boa noite!

 

Só q envéz de aparecer o nome do usuario aparece a palavra OK ...

pq esta assim aonde eu estou errando?

Compartilhar este post


Link para o post
Compartilhar em outros sites

existem varios tópicos e artigos sobre o assunto , dê uma pesquisada

exemplo

Compartilhar este post


Link para o post
Compartilhar em outros sites

Galera estou usando o seguinte codigo como fazer

 

login.asp

<%   

   set db = server.createobject("adodb.connection") 'Banco de Dados
   set rs = server.createobject("adodb.recordset")  'Tabela de Registros

   'Path (Caminho) do Banco 
   db.open "driver={microsoft access driver (*.mdb)};dbq=" & _
   	Server.MapPath("../dados/dados.mdb")

   'Selecionamos o usuario da tabela usuarios.
   'Usamos o Replace para garantir a segurança e que o usuário um pouco 
   'mais experiente não modifique a sintaxe SQL
   
   rs.open "select * from admin where " & _
   	"nome='" & Replace(request.form("nome"), "'", "''") & _
   	"' and senha='" & Replace(request.form("senha"), "'", "''") & "'",db
   
      if not rs.eof then 'Encontrou o usuário
	  	'Armazenamos em uma variável Session o status do Usuário
	     session("status") = "ok" 
		 'Redirecionamos para a Página Inicial	
	     response.redirect("entra.asp") 
      else 'Usuário não encontrado
	  	'Redirecionamos para a Página de Login e informamos o erro
	     response.redirect("index.asp?erro=negado") 
      end if

      set rs = nothing 'Destruímos o Objeto
      rs.close
      
%>

entrar.asp

<%

   if not session("status") = "ok" then
   	  'Redirecionamos para a Página de Login e informamos o erro	
      response.redirect("login.asp?erro=negado") 
      'Lembrando que o response.redirect deve ser usado antes 
	  'de qualquer saída HTML.
   else
   %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
<title>Untitled Document</title>
</head>

<body>

Olá <%Session("status")%>
<script language="JavaScript"><!--
    var d = new Date()
    var h = d.getHours()
    if (h < 6)
        document.red(" - Boa Madrugada!")
    else
    if (h < 12)
        document.write(" - Bom dia!")
    else
        if (h < 18)
            document.write(" - Boa tarde!")
     else
            document.write(" - Boa noite!")
// -->
</script>
<p>

</body>
</html>
<%
   end if
   
%>

oq tenho q mudar neste codigo p/ funcionar 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.